This is out at Dockyard in the extreme west end of Bermuda. This was a large Royal Navy fortress and port built over a century ago. For a long time it was left abandoned but over the last twenty years it has been developed into a tourist destination with retail stores in the old stone wharehouses. There are also several good restaurants and a high speed ferry boat can have you back in Hamilton in about twenty minutes unfortunately there are long periods during the day when the ferry does not run. If you take the bus back to Hamilton it will take more than hour.
